Transaction 951cb3a74b544e96e45c206e721a66d2b2b7bd91faacbf1befa35d487d7016c7

4 Input
2 Outputs
  • 951cb3a74b544e96e45c206e721a66d2b2b7bd91faacbf1befa35d487d7016c7:0
  • value  1747005
    address  1PTjf7iCoN9xpuGjEDr4xT9sHcHzWPKZrJ
  • 951cb3a74b544e96e45c206e721a66d2b2b7bd91faacbf1befa35d487d7016c7:1
  • value  537873420
    address  3BMEXLPTNKBfW1kdNxpmWYwhz5i4nT6npE